This week we had a successful mural inauguration. The mural inauguration is important as it provides an opportunity for the participants, myself, collaborating artist, school director and any other important stakeholders to recognize the work we have accomplished and acknowledge each other. I felt an immense sense of accomplishments and satisfaction during our big day. Even though we have our last touches to add to “clean up” the mural, finish details and as perfect as possible, it felt great to recognize our effort and share with the school at large. We painted Monday-Tuesday, December 9-10. On December 11, 2013 there was a school wide “fun day” and our mural inauguration/dedication. I was able to write the dedication on the wall acknowledging the vision of the project and distinguishing the key people responsible for its completion.

During the ceremony I presented a Powerpoint presentation which explained the concept of Innovative Initiatives, my and my collaborating artist’s roles and responsibilities, a description of each phase with accompanying pictures, accomplishments, and before & after pictures. The pictures really made an impact and showed the differences. So, I will show before and after pictures once we are finished with detailing the mural.
